Utah mother still unfit for trial in 2-year-old's death

SALT LAKE CITY (AP) — A judge says a northern Utah woman is still not mentally fit to stand trial in the death of her 2-year-old son.

Lawyer David Perry said Monday that 43-year-old Heidi Marie Rutchey has been treated at the Utah State Hospital for a year, but administrators report she remains incompetent for trial.

Rutchey faces a murder charge in the August 2013 death of her son Eli. Court records show she tried to kill herself and told staffers at a Logan hospital she had suffocated her son in a bathtub.

Authorities went to her house in River Heights and found the boy, who they believe had been dead for several days.

Cache Valley Daily reports Judge Brandon Maynard ruled she remains unfit for trial and set a new hearing for next year.
